# Searchbright Environments

Quick note for on-call: the nightly reindex kicks off from the Amberfall scheduler around 02:10 local. If it stalls, check the staging cluster first — it shares the indexer pool and hogs workers sometimes. Prod and staging differ only in shard count and batch size. Prod's indexer runs with the following configuration values.

config for kafof-bawef:
holath:
  log_level: debug
  metrics_host: metrics.holath.qorvelsys.internal
  pin: 2191
  pool_size: 32

**Onboarding: LiftLab Simulator**

New joiners should start with LiftLab, our elevator-dispatch simulator used to test scheduling heuristics before they ship to the Vantor Tower pilot. Clone the repo, run the bootstrap script, and replay the canned traffic profiles under scenarios/peak-morning. Results land in the shared dashboard within a few minutes. We review anomalies at the weekly eng sync, so flag anything odd before Thursday. If the bootstrap fails or a scenario won't load, reach out to the simulator maintainers directly.

escalation mailbox, badug-tawip: ulaath@nelvroforge.example

## Escalation

If the PinPoint address autocomplete widget returns empty suggestions for more than five minutes, first verify the geodata index job completed overnight; a stale index is the most common cause. If the index is current, check upstream lookup latency on the widget dashboard. Only page the on-call after both checks. For non-urgent defects or data-quality reports, send full reproduction details to the maintainers.

escalation mailbox, bafog-fafog: ulador@paliqlabs.internal